没有合适的资源?快使用搜索试试~ 我知道了~
restz-framework:ResTZ是用Java编写的可扩展REST客户端框架,可处理常见情况(例如,序列化,OAuth令...
共75个文件
java:67个
xml:6个
md:1个
需积分: 9 0 下载量 28 浏览量
2021-05-19
11:38:43
上传
评论
收藏 78KB ZIP 举报
温馨提示
ResTZ框架 ResTZ是用Java编写的可扩展REST客户端框架。 编写ResTZ的原因主要有以下三个: 就REST客户端而言,存在大量共享代码(例如,连接池管理,序列化,oauth令牌到期等)。 在Jive Software中,我们与几乎所有已知的企业服务集成在一起,这种框架节省了我们很多时间和精力。 我们希望能够共享REST API本身,而不依赖于特定的HttpClient版本。 Apache倾向于跨版本(甚至是次要版本)破坏HttpClient的API,因此,除非将其设置为(这实际上与编写ResTZ一样困难)-代码库越大,合并它的可能性就越大。在某一方面的变化。 入门 将任何一个ResTZ HttpClient连接器添加为项目的Maven依赖项 < dependency> < groupId>com.jivesoftware.boundaries.restz</ g
资源推荐
资源详情
资源评论
收起资源包目录
restz-framework-master.zip (75个子文件)
restz-framework-master
restz-hc432
src
main
java
com
jivesoftware
boundaries
restz
hc432
HC432ExecutorFactory.java 2KB
HC432Executor.java 10KB
HC432ConnectionCloser.java 559B
pom.xml 2KB
restz
src
main
java
com
jivesoftware
boundaries
restz
LayerCollection.java 1KB
DummyConnectionCloser.java 253B
layers
oauth2
TokenExpiredException.java 462B
AbstractOAuth2Layer.java 2KB
TokenRevokedException.java 233B
BasicOAuth2Layer.java 911B
OAuth2Token.java 768B
OAuth2Client.java 538B
basic
BasicAuthLayer.java 1KB
RecoverableFailureLayer.java 587B
ExecutionWrapperLayer.java 476B
RequestBuilder.java 2KB
exceptions
HttpFailureException.java 764B
CheckedAsRuntimeException.java 387B
FailureException.java 408B
UnknownFailureException.java 272B
HttpVerb.java 161B
Layer.java 120B
strategies
SmartReadingStrategy.java 3KB
SerializerReadingStrategy.java 1KB
ResponseReadingStrategy.java 698B
Response.java 1KB
ResTZ.java 9KB
ConnectionClosingInputStream.java 631B
Executor.java 216B
ResponseEntity.java 981B
ExecutorFactory.java 160B
multipart
TextPart.java 775B
Part.java 357B
BinaryPart.java 936B
FilePart.java 317B
InputStreamPart.java 352B
ByteArrayPart.java 309B
MultipartEntityBuilder.java 3KB
ConnectionCloser.java 168B
serializing
GsonSerializer.java 1KB
Serializer.java 369B
pom.xml 1KB
restz-hc435
src
main
java
com
jivesoftware
boundaries
restz
hc435
HC435Executor.java 10KB
HC435ExecutorFactory.java 2KB
HC435ConnectionCloser.java 559B
pom.xml 2KB
LICENSE 9KB
restz-usecase
src
main
java
com
jivesoftware
boundaries
restz
usecase
box
api
models
BoxFile.java 2KB
BoxObject.java 386B
BoxFolder.java 974B
BoxFileCollection.java 570B
BoxUser.java 627B
BoxCreateFolderRequestObject.java 418B
exceptions
BoxFolderAlreadyExists.java 176B
BoxApi.java 4KB
Engine.java 3KB
office
restz
OfficeOAuth2Token.java 421B
OfficeOAuth2Client.java 438B
DStrippingGsonSerializer.java 1KB
api
models
common
DigestContext.java 815B
DeferredResource.java 592B
creation
SiteCreationResponse.java 3KB
FileUploadResponse.java 6KB
FolderCreation.java 790B
FolderCreationResponse.java 3KB
SiteCreation.java 2KB
InstanceProperties.java 296B
OfficeApi.java 8KB
Engine.java 4KB
pom.xml 2KB
README.md 6KB
pom.xml 1KB
restz-hc400
src
main
java
com
jivesoftware
boundaries
restz
hc400
HC400ExecutorFactory.java 2KB
HC400Executor.java 10KB
pom.xml 2KB
共 75 条
- 1
资源评论
看起来很年长的一条鱼
- 粉丝: 34
- 资源: 4612
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功